About Cindy Grimm
Cindy Grimm is a scholar working on Computer Vision and Pattern Recognition, Computer Graphics and Computer-Aided Design, Computational Mechanics, Human-Computer Interaction and Control and Systems Engineering, having authored 139 papers that have together received 2.0k indexed citations. Recurring topics across this work include Computer Graphics and Visualization Techniques (42 papers), 3D Shape Modeling and Analysis (30 papers), Advanced Vision and Imaging (22 papers), Advanced Numerical Analysis Techniques (22 papers), Interactive and Immersive Displays (13 papers), Robot Manipulation and Learning (13 papers), Smart Agriculture and AI (11 papers) and Visual Attention and Saliency Detection (10 papers). The work is most often cited by research in Computer Graphics and Computer-Aided Design (505 citations), Human-Computer Interaction (326 citations), Computer Vision and Pattern Recognition (945 citations), Computational Mechanics (619 citations) and Geology (81 citations). Cindy Grimm has collaborated with scholars based in United States, Canada and United Kingdom. Frequent co-authors include Reynold Bailey, Ann McNamara, H.S. Malvar, Brian Guenter, John F. Hughes, William D. Smart, Daniel Wood, Brian Wyvill, Ryan Schmidt and Daniel N. Wood. Their work appears in journals such as The Visual Computer, IEEE Robotics and Automation Letters, Journal of Biomechanical Engineering, Computers and Electronics in Agriculture and IEEE Transactions on Visualization and Computer Graphics.
